Joplin woman killed; motorcyclist cited for DWI, manslaughter

A Joplin woman, riding as a passenger on a motorcycle, was killed and the driver cited for driving while intoxicated and felony manslaughter following a one-vehicle accident 1:45 a.m. today on MO 86, five miles south of Joplin.

According to the Highway Patrol report, a 2012 Harley Davidson driven by Bryan W. McCutcheon, 45, Joplin, ran off the roadway and overturned, ejecting McCutcheon and his passenger, Chelsey R. McCutcheon, 32, Joplin.

Chelsey McCutcheon was pronounced dead at the scene at 1:49 a.m. by Newton County Coroner Brian Artherton.

Bryan McCutcheon was treated for serious injuries at Mercy Hospital, Joplin.

In addition to DWI and manslaughter, McCutcheon was cited for careless and imprudent driving.

The fatality was the 55th this year for Highway Patrol Troop D.
